OCR or Optical Character Recognition,is a technology that enables you to convert different types of documents, such as scanned paper documents, PDF files or images captured by a digital camera into editable and searchable data.

The popularity of OCR has been increasing each year with the advent of fast microprocessors providing the vehicle for vastly improved recognition techniques. Data Entry through OCR is faster, more accurate, and generally more efficient than keystroke data entry.

Optical Character Recognition (OCR) is usually about big flatbed scanners and expensive software.So we listed 5 free OCR Scanning Websites for those who are looking for an online service that offers free OCR scanning.

5 Free OCR Scanning Websites

1.Free OCR :

Free OCR does exactly what it claims: Nothing more and nothing less. Upload an image and this site translates it into plain text, which you can copy and paste to a document on your PC. No site registration is required.

Supported formats:
PDF, JPG, GIF, TIFF or BMP files with a maximum file size of 2 MB and there is a limit of 10 image uploads per hour. The OCR currently supports the six languages English, German, Spanish, French, Italian and Dutch.

2. OCR Terminal

OCR Terminal is an free online Optical Character Recognition service that allows you to convert scanned images and pdf’s into editable and text searchable documents. It accurately preserves formatting and layout of documents.

In order to use free version,you must register an account and it allows you to process up to 20 scanned pages per month.

Supported formats:
supports all popular document image formats PDF, TIFF, PNG, JPEG to Word, TXT, RTF and PDF. Extracted text can be downloaded in TXT, DOC, XML or RTF formats or directly e-mailed with a thumbnail of the uploaded image.The site currently allows for text extraction only from English language documents.

3. InstantOCR

INSTANT OCR is a web based OCR program. Simply, it makes Optical Character Recognition process to image file , pdf file or a scanned document which is uploaded to the ocr server by user and send results back via mail.No site registration is required

Supported formats:
jpeg , jpg , giff , tiff etc files and Instant OCR supports 12 languages, English, German, Spanish, French, Italian,Danish,Japanese(Currently not working),Portuguese,Turkish,polish,Finish and Czech.Also you can use InstantOCR as a pdf converter.

4.WeOCR servers

WeOCR is a platform that allows people to use OCR (Optical Character Reader / Recognition) through the network. WeOCR server receives images of the users, recognizes text in images, and return recognition results to users. Select an image file to the server WeOCR top of the page and click “Acknowledge” button. You will see the results of character recognition on the screen of the web browser.

Accepted formats: BMP, JPEG, PBM / PGM / PPM, and gzipped are accepted.

5.ABBYY FineReader Online:

This is based on ABYY intelligent award-winning OCR technology,for free version registration is required and it process up to 50 pages a day not more than 10 Mb .
Supported formats:
supports all popular document image formats.Output formats are Microsoft Word and Excel, PDF, RTF and TXT.This OCR supports 4 languages Russian, English, German and French.
